    How do you transfer Microsoft Office to a new laptop?

    My old one crashed about 8 months ago(yeah I know, I've taken my time to ask this) and I had Office 2007 on it. I need to transfer it to my new laptop now that the trial version has run out. Naturally, I can't just type in the authorization code into my new laptop. So how do you do it? Apparently 49 freaking dollars to talk to Microsoft's help line for Office.

    I don't think it's possible. You have to re-install it because you're also talking keys that must go into the registry. I would call customer service, not tech support and explain your situation and let them know the code that you have. They might give you a new one for free or let that code go through again.
